
Katerina Siniakova defeated Coco Gauff 6-2 6-4 in the Doha round of 32 on hard. The upset overturned the form book — Coco Gauff came in ranked #7, leading the head-to-head 5–1, defending last year's quarter-final. Katerina Siniakova narrowed the head-to-head to 5–2.
